Decoding the Apollo3 Datasheet A Developer’s Essential Guide
The Apollo3 Datasheet serves as the definitive reference for all things related to the Apollo3 family of microcontrollers. It meticulously outlines every aspect of the chip’s functionality, from its processing core to its peripherals and memory organization. Think of it as the blueprint for understanding the inner workings of the Apollo3. Without it, maximizing its potential is like trying to build a complex structure without the proper architectural plans. The datasheet typically includes:
- Detailed pinout diagrams, showing the function of each pin.
- Electrical characteristics, such as voltage ranges and power consumption.
- Memory map, outlining the organization of RAM and Flash memory.
The primary users of the Apollo3 Datasheet are hardware and software engineers involved in designing embedded systems. Hardware engineers rely on the datasheet to understand the electrical characteristics and pin configurations, ensuring correct integration of the microcontroller into their circuit designs. Software engineers use the datasheet to understand the memory map, peripheral registers, and instruction set architecture, allowing them to write efficient and effective code. Its importance lies in providing precise and reliable information, minimizing design errors, and optimizing performance for specific applications.
